§ 40:37-95.33 — Submission of adoption of act to voters

The question of the adoption of the provisions of this act, in the form set forth in section 4 hereof, shall be submitted to the legal voters of any county which has heretofore or hereafter shall adopt the provisions of chapter 276 of the laws of 1946, at the next general election succeeding the passage hereof or at the general election at which the adoption of said chapter 276 of the laws of 1946 shall be submitted, whichever shall first occur. L.1954, c. 247, p. 908, s. 3.
